Take PPF, a government-backed long-term savings scheme with tax-free returns. Also known as Public Provident Fund, it’s one of the most reliable tools for Indian families building long-term wealth. Compare that to fixed deposits, shorter-term savings with fixed interest but taxable earnings. Also known as FDs, they’re safer for emergencies but won’t grow your money as well over 15+ years. If you’re serious about wealth, PPF often wins. Then there’s gold loans, using your gold jewelry as collateral to get quick cash. Also known as gold collateral loans, they can help you avoid selling assets or taking high-interest personal loans—but only if you repay on time, because missed payments can hurt your credit score. And if you’re thinking about starting a business, Startup India, a government program that helps new businesses get loans up to ₹5 crore. Also known as Indian startup funding scheme, it doesn’t give free money, but it opens doors to low-cost loans with no collateral for up to ₹2 crore. What Is the 15-15-15 Rule for Investing in India?

The 15-15-15 rule is a simple investment strategy for building wealth in India: invest ₹15,000 monthly for 15 years in equity mutual funds at 15% annual returns to reach ₹1 crore. It works because of compounding and India’s strong market growth.
